Descale With Vinegar

Clean an electric kettle by descaling with vinegar. Mix equal parts vinegar and water, then boil the solution. Rinse thoroughly to remove any residue.

Vinegar Solution

Mix water and vinegar in equal parts. Fill the kettle halfway. Use white vinegar for best results. This helps remove lime scale.

Soaking Time

Let the solution sit for 30 minutes. This soaking time is important. It helps dissolve the mineral deposits. After soaking, pour out the solution. Rinse the kettle several times with clean water. This removes any vinegar taste. Finally, boil fresh water in the kettle. Pour it out to ensure it is clean.

Use Lemon For Freshness

Cleaning an electric kettle is easy with lemon. Slice a lemon, add to water, and boil. Rinse well for a fresh, clean kettle.

Lemon Solution

First, fill the kettle halfway with water. Next, add the juice of one lemon. Lemon juice helps remove stains and odors. Boil the water with the lemon juice. Then, let it sit for 30 minutes. Pour out the water and rinse the kettle well.

Rinsing Steps

After boiling the lemon solution, pour it out. Fill the kettle with fresh water. Boil the water again. This step removes any lemon residue. Pour out the water and rinse the kettle thoroughly. Dry the kettle with a clean cloth.

Regular Maintenance




Descale your kettle every three months. Limescale builds up fast. Use vinegar or a descaling solution. Fill the kettle halfway with the solution. Boil it, then let it cool. Rinse it well to remove any residue. This keeps your kettle in good shape.

Empty the kettle after each use. Wipe the inside to remove any water drops. This prevents mineral deposits. Do not leave water inside overnight. Dry the outside with a cloth. Keep the lid open to let it air dry.
